LAG-1 (CCL4L1)
Description:
LAG-1 is CC chemokine that signals through the CCR5 receptor. LAG-1 is identical to MIP-1beta (ACT II isotype) except for two amino acid substitutions; arginine for histidine at position 22 and serine for glycine at position 47 of the mature protein. LAG-1 chemoattracts monocytes, and exhibits activity as an HIV suppressive factor. Recombinant human LAG-1 is a 7.7 kDa protein containing 69 amino acid residues.Synonyms:
